Between 2005 and 2013, Spanish Air Force completed 43 rotations deployments to Afghanistan with Super Puma helicopters as part of HELISAF (search and rescue) mission saving 1030 lives.

The Ejército del Aire (Spanish Air Force) was officially renamed the Ejército del Aire y del Espacio (Spanish Air and Space Force) on 27 January 2022, following Royal Decree 61/2022. The change reflected Spain’s decision to incorporate space operations into the responsibilities of the armed forces, aligning with similar moves by other NATO members.
